French door glass replacement services involve removing and replacing the glass panels within existing French-style doors. This process typically includes carefully taking out the damaged or broken glass, cleaning and preparing the door frame, and installing new, clear, or decorative glass panes. The goal is to restore the door’s appearance and functionality while ensuring the new glass fits securely and looks seamless with the overall door design. Skilled contractors can handle both single-pane and multi-pane configurations, offering options that suit different aesthetic preferences and functional needs.
This service helps address several common problems homeowners face with their French doors. Cracked or shattered glass can compromise security and safety, while foggy or cloudy panes reduce visibility and diminish the door’s visual appeal. Additionally, damaged or outdated glass may lead to drafts, heat loss, or increased energy costs. Replacing the glass can improve insulation, enhance curb appeal, and restore the door’s structural integrity. It’s also a practical solution for those wanting to upgrade to more modern or decorative glass styles without replacing the entire door.

The overview below groups typical French Door Glass Replacement proj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Albany, NY.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or glass replacements in French doors usually range from $250 to $600. Many routine repairs fall within this middle band, depending on the size and type of glass needed. Fewer projects reach into the higher end of the range for more complex or custom glass options.
Full Door Glass Replacement - Replacing the entire glass panel in a French door generally costs between $600 and $1,200. Most local contractors handle these projects within this range, with larger or more intricate replacements sometimes exceeding $1,200.
Custom or Specialty Glass - Specialty glass, such as beveled or decorative options, can increase costs to $1,000-$2,500 or more. These projects are less common and often fall into the higher cost tier due to custom fabrication and materials.
Large or Complex Installations - Large-scale or multi-pane replacements for French doors can reach $2,500 to $5,000+ depending on the scope and complexity. Such projects are less frequent and typically involve extensive customization or structural modifications.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What types of glass are available for French door replacements? Local contractors often offer a variety of glass options, including clear, frosted, and decorative styles, to suit different aesthetic and functional preferences.
Can French door glass be replaced without removing the entire door? Yes, many service providers can replace the glass pane while keeping the existing door frame intact, depending on the door's design and condition.
Are there options for energy-efficient glass in French door replacements? Yes, many local service providers can install energy-efficient glass, such as double-pane or low-E glass, to improve insulation and reduce energy costs.
Is it possible to upgrade to more secure or shatter-resistant glass? Yes, contractors can often replace existing glass with more durable options like laminated or tempered glass for added security and safety.
What should be considered when choosing glass for a French door replacement? Factors such as durability, energy efficiency, privacy, and aesthetic appeal are important considerations when selecting glass for replacement projects.
